Richard and Louise Varco Scholarship
Scholarship Sponsored by Saint Paul and Minnesota Communication Foundation
Overview
The Richard and Louise Varco Scholarship was created to support students who intend to pursue further study at an accredited college, university, or vocational-technical school located in Minnesota.
Who is eligible
Applicants must meet one of the following:
- Be a high school senior, a high school graduate, or a current postsecondary student at the undergraduate, graduate, or professional level; AND plan to enroll full time for the entire 2026–2027 academic year at an accredited two‑ or four‑year college, university, or vocational-technical school in Minnesota. A minimum cumulative GPA of 2.5 on a 4.0 scale (or equivalent) is required.
- OR be a worker who has been displaced under extraordinary circumstances and intends to enroll in a retraining program at an accredited two‑ or four‑year college, university, or vocational-technical school in Minnesota for the full 2026–2027 academic year.
Award information
- The Saint Paul & Minnesota Foundation determines the total amount available for awards each year from the Richard and Louise Varco Scholarship Fund.
- Individual awards will not exceed $5,000.
- Awards are one-time (not renewable). Eligible students may reapply each year they continue to meet the criteria.
How recipients are chosen
Scholarship America makes recipient selections based on the following factors:
- Academic record
- Demonstrated leadership and participation in school and community activities
- Work experience
- Statement of educational and career goals
- Unusual personal or family circumstances
- An online recommendation
In addition, financial need as calculated by Scholarship America must be demonstrated for a student to receive an award. Selection decisions are made solely by Scholarship America; neither officers nor employees of the Saint Paul & Minnesota Foundation are involved in choosing recipients. Not all applicants will receive awards, and applicants must accept Scholarship America’s decision as final.
Application materials and requirements
To complete your application you must upload the following documents electronically:
- A current, complete transcript. Grade reports are not acceptable. The transcript must show:
- Student name
- School name
- Grades
- Credit hours for each course and the term in which the course was taken
Note: If you submit SAT or ACT scores and those scores do not appear on your high school transcript, upload an official copy of the test report(s). Test scores are not required when you submit a college transcript.
- One online recommendation must be submitted on your behalf by February 27, 2026 at 3:00 PM Central Time. Your application will be considered incomplete until all required materials (including the recommendation and transcript) have been submitted electronically.
Notification and payment
- All applicants will be notified of award decisions in April. Notifications are sent by email—do not use a school or employer email address when creating your application account; provide a personal email address you will retain access to.
- Scholarship America administers payments on behalf of the Saint Paul & Minnesota Foundation. Scholarship funds are disbursed in a single installment in early August.
